History of the photo

World War I. Visit in Paris of Woodrow Wilson (1856-1924), American statesman. Mr and Mrs Wilson leaving a Presbyterian church. Paris, on December 15, 1918. Photograph published in the newspaper "Excelsior", on December 16, 1918.
